Nominator statement
He is a very dynamic person. He developed IT and network in Etisalat. With his talent now less then 1 year Etisalat is at par or even much better compared to other mobile operators in Afghanistan.
Nominee statement
My big task now in my company (Etisalat Afghanistan) is to take the lead role in Determine Corporate Strategy and Design the Base Station and entire Mobile Network in Afghanistan along with managing Marketing requirement activity within an assigned geographical region.
Responsible for the preparing budget process from initial point of planning, presentations, proposals, through contract negotiations and execution. Meet/exceed minimum quarterly and annual company objectives.
Work closely with the operational and project teams, utilize relationships to ensure that project implementation schedules are met.
Facilitate strategic partners' resources to assist in the project implementation process.
Engage, equip, and lead all department channels with appropriate training, tools, and strategy development.
EXPERIENCES GAINED:
Experience in preparing budget, design the network and monitoring the company performance.
ACCOMPLISHMENT:
Promoted as Director after 4 month in service. Previously as IT Support Manager
Before I joint Etisalat Afghanistan, I was in Bangladesh as a Country Manager for South Pacific Communication, one of the biggest "Approved Service Provider" of Ericsson Asia Pacific. As ASP of Ericsson, my former company act as a consultant and contractor to all Ericsson Customer in Bangladesh to set up their network.
Furthermore I also have 6 years experience with Celcom Malaysia (the biggest mobile operator in Malaysia) as Head of Network Planning Department in one of Malaysia Region.
With this vast experience I think I can contribute as EC member very well.
